Frequently Asked Questions

Which ski pass do you need?

  • Beginner Boost: Kick off your ski adventure with full speed! On the first day, we recommend a practice lift ticket to get started right away. Lift tickets can be purchased at the lift pass office.
  • Your choice, your style: Are you a lightweight intermediate or an experienced rider? Choose between the 3 Valleys ski pass and the Ski Arlberg pass. For private trips to Lech, the Ski Arlberg pass is perfect. In the ski course, we recommend the 3 Valleys ski pass with the option for a switch card.
  • Together into freedom: For the extended slopes of Ski Arlberg, everyone from our crew needs a valid Ski Arlberg ski pass. If you already have a 3 Valleys ticket for at least 3 days, discounted "Ski Arlberg switch day tickets" are available.

Difficulty Level

Classification Levels for Ski Course

  • E1 Beginner: You are skiing for the first time.
  • E2 Slightly advanced: You can already ski simple blue slopes independently.
  • E3 Advanced: You master skiing on red slopes (without snowplowing) independently.
  • E4 Professional: You glide smoothly on all slopes and master the rhythm.
